Extended Observations

A complete, well-considered spray foam insulation kit that covers 240 board feet and arrives with everything a serious DIYer needs to actually finish the job — gun, cleaner, and safety gear included.

Most spray foam insulation kits sell you the cans and leave you to figure out the rest. The BEEST FullStop takes a different approach: 12 cans, a Pro X applicator gun, solvent cleaner, and a full set of safety gear arrive together, which means the job can start the same day the box lands on your doorstep. For a homeowner tackling an attic rim joist, a crawl space, or a stubborn wall cavity, that kind of completeness matters more than it might first appear.

The coverage claim is 240 board feet, which translates to a meaningful amount of real-world sealing — enough to address most single-room or targeted attic projects without a second order. The foam itself is a closed-cell formulation with a competitive R-value per inch, and it adheres well to wood, concrete, and metal framing. The Pro X gun gives you genuine control over bead width and flow rate, which separates this from the basic straw-applicator kits that make consistent coverage a guessing game.

Acoustic performance is a secondary benefit worth naming. Closed-cell foam at adequate depth does measurable work on sound transmission — not a replacement for dedicated acoustic panels, but a real improvement in a shared wall or between a garage and living space. Homeowners who've been chasing a noise problem alongside a thermal one will find that the FullStop addresses both in a single application.

The included solvent cleaner is a practical detail that competitors often omit. Uncured foam is notoriously unforgiving on skin, clothing, and applicator tips, and having the right cleaner on hand from the start prevents the kind of avoidable mess that turns a weekend project into a frustrating one. The safety gear — gloves, goggles — rounds out a package that treats the user as someone who's actually going to do the work.

Two caveats worth noting: the 12-can count will not stretch to cover a full attic floor in a larger home, so plan your square footage carefully before ordering. And like all two-component foam systems, temperature sensitivity during application is real — the product performs best between 60°F and 90°F, which requires some scheduling discipline in colder climates. Neither issue undermines the kit's value, but both deserve a place in your planning.
